Inclusion criteria

Inclusion criteria: Inclusion Criteria (study 1 only) 1. Male 2. 18-60 years of age 3. Participants in the following groups will be recruited: Control Group: Healthy participants Disease Groups: Participants with chronic diseases e.g. diabetes mellitus, obesity Inclusion Criteria (study 2 only) 1. Male 2. Known infertility 3. 18-60 years of age 4. Current lifestyle factors known to affect fertility (e.g. any raised BMI, smoking, recreational drug use, excessive alcohol intake) which remain despite any previous lifestyle advice gained in the NHS

Exclusion criteria

Exclusion criteria: 1. History of anaemia 2. Needle-phobia 3. Acute illness likely to affect the result of study 4. Impaired ability to provide full consent to take part in the study

Design outcomes

Primary

MeasureTime frame
Part 1: Sperm count abnormalities will be measured using routine semen analysis at baseline. Part 2: Sperm count abnormalities will be measured using routine semen analysis at baseline, 2, 3, 4 and 5 weeks.

Secondary

MeasureTime frame
Part 2: 1. Weight, measured using scales at baseline, 2, 3, 4 and 5 weeks 2. Serum reproductive hormones using automated immunoassays at baseline, 2, 3, 4 and 5 weeks 3. Serum metabolic parameters using automated immunoassays at baseline, 2, 3, 4 and 5 weeks
